Transaction 12035d95427a0a5d7a78d3a3a83ba1f6a610ad9303378f0c64429e5d427a918a
1 Input
1 Output
-
12035d95427a0a5d7a78d3a3a83ba1f6a610ad9303378f0c64429e5d427a918a:0
- value
- 1111607
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1017650e012c006da8a6a8405c796d6db3820fb2 OP_EQUAL
- address
- 33A6m7ExvNWA163Lijx55h3L2oa89B2FUV